Multiple Choice Questions-1
Society
1. In Sociology, ‘Society’ refers to the ——
     a)      Members of a specific in-group
     b)      Pattern of the norms of interaction
     c)      Congregation of people     
     d)      People with laws and customs
Ans :- B

2. Society is the total social heritage of folkways, mores and Institutions, of habits, sentiments and ideals. This is a —— view of society.
     a)      Structural
     b)      Cultural
     c)      Functional
     d)      None of the above
Ans :- A

3. Who among the following has given the structural view of society?
     a)      Durkheim
     b)      Giddings 
     c)      MacIver
     d)      Cooley
Ans :- B

4. Who among the following has given the functional view of society?
     a)      Giddings
     b)      August Comte
     c)      Parsons
     d)      Spencer
Ans :- C

5. According to ............. society is a web of social relations.
     a)      Cooley
     b)      MacIver
     c)      Parsons
     d)      Leacock
Ans :- B

6. The relation existing between a type writer and a desk can be called--
     a)      Material
     b)      Cultural   
     c)      Physical
     d)      Structural
Ans :- C

7. The relationship between fire and smoke is not a social one as the very relationship is not in any way determined by ——--
     a)      Co-operation 
     b)      Mutual awareness
     c)      Integration
     d)      Social compulsion
Ans :- B

8. According to Giddings, society rests on --
     a)      Mutual co-operation 
     b)      Altruism  
     c)      Consciousness of kind 
     d)      Folkways and mores
Ans :- C

9. Find out the incorrect match
     a)      Giddings ——structural view of society
     b)      Cooley —— society is a web of social relationships
     c)      Parsons — functional view of society
     d)      Cooley— ‘we’ feeling.
Ans :- B

10. ‘Man is a social animal.’ Who said this?
     a)      MacIver
     b)      Freud       
     c)      Aristotle
     d)      Rousseau
Ans :- C

11. — is a system of relationship between cells
     a)      Society
     b)      Aggregation
     c)      Organism
     d)      Group
Ans :- C

12. Who has compared society with an organism?
     a)      Darwin
     b)      Durkheim   
     c)      Spencer
     d)      MacIver
Ans :- C

13. Patriarchal theory has been propounded by --
     a)      Tylor  
     b)      Henry Maine   
     c)      Aristotle 
     d)      Morgan
Ans :- B

14. According to — theory, individuals made a mutual agreement and created society
     a)      Patriarchal
     b)      Social contract
     c)      Agreement
     d)      Divine origin
Ans :- B

15. According to ——, the life of man was solitary, poor, nasty, brutish and short’
     a)      Rousseau
     b)      Locke           
     c)      Plato
     d)      None of the above
Ans :- D

16. Society is not a make, but a growth. This view is related to —--
     a)      Patriarchaltheory
     b)      Matriarchal theory
     c)      Divine origin theory
     d)      Evolutionary theory
Ans :- D

17. Animal society is based on —— whereas human society is based on —--
     a)      Instincts, reason
     b)      Sex drives, cultural needs
     c)      Strength, knowledge
     d)      None of the above
Ans :- A

18. ———the process by which the individual learns to conform to the norms of the group
     a)      Integration
     b)      Socialization
     c)      Conformity
     d)      Assimilation
Ans :- B

19. Socialization is a matter of —--
     a)      Learning  
     b)      Biological inheritance
     c)      Socialising
     d)      Division of labour
Ans :- A

20. Sociality is a —— and socialization is a —--
     a)      Quality, Process
     b)      Principle, biological Inheritance
     c)      Cultural process, virtue
     d)      None of the above
Ans :- A

21.The social order is maintained largely by —--
     a)      Division of labour
     b)      Law
     c)      Socialization
     d)      State
Ans :- C

22. The process of imitation may be perceptual or ——--
     a)      Conscious
     b)      Deliberate        
     c)      Spontaneous
     d)      Ideational
Ans :- D

23. —— is the process of communicating information which has no logical or self-evident basis
     a)      Suggestion
     b)      Imitation      
     c)      Transculturation
     d)      Accommodation
Ans :- A

24.When the child attempts to walk with a stick like his father, he is following —— a factor responsible in the process of socialization?
     a)      Identification
     b)      Suggestion        
     c)      Imitation
     d)      Conformity
Ans :- C

25. —— is the means of cultural transmission
     a)      Education
     b)      Society         
     c)      Language
     d)      Archaeology
Ans :- C
